تطبيق الترخيص على Aspose.Words لـ Java

في هذا البرنامج التعليمي، سنرشدك خلال عملية تطبيق الترخيص على Aspose.Words for Java. يعد الترخيص أمرًا ضروريًا لفتح الإمكانات الكاملة لـ Aspose.Words والتأكد من أن تطبيقك يمكنه استخدامه دون أي قيود. سنزودك بكود المصدر اللازم ونرشدك حول كيفية إعداد الترخيص بشكل فعال.

1. مقدمة للترخيص في Aspose.Words لـ Java

Aspose.Words for Java هي مكتبة قوية لمعالجة المستندات تتيح لك إنشاء مستندات Word وتحريرها ومعالجتها برمجيًا. لاستخدامه بشكل فعال، تحتاج إلى تطبيق ترخيص صالح. بدون ترخيص، يعمل Aspose.Words في الوضع التجريبي مع وجود قيود.

2. الحصول على الترخيص

قبل أن تتمكن من التقدم للحصول على ترخيص، يتعين عليك الحصول على واحد. يقدم Aspose خيارات ترخيص متنوعة، بما في ذلك التراخيص المؤقتة والدائمة. للحصول على الترخيص قم بزيارةAspose صفحة الشراء.

3. إعداد بيئة التطوير الخاصة بك

للبدء، تأكد من تثبيت Aspose.Words for Java في بيئة التطوير لديك. يمكنك تنزيله منصفحة التنزيلات Aspose. بمجرد التثبيت، يمكنك البدء في الترميز.

4. طلب الترخيص

الآن، دعنا نطبق الترخيص على تطبيق Aspose.Words for Java الخاص بك. ستحتاج إلى كود المصدر التالي:

License license = new License();
try {
    license.setLicense("Aspose.Words.lic");
    System.out.println("License set successfully.");
} catch (Exception e) {
    System.out.println("\nThere was an error setting the license: " + e.getMessage());
}

يقوم هذا الرمز بتهيئة الترخيص ومحاولة تعيينه. تأكد من استبدال"Aspose.Words.lic" مع المسار إلى ملف الترخيص الخاص بك.

5. التعامل مع استثناءات الترخيص

من المهم التعامل مع استثناءات الترخيص بأمان. إذا كانت هناك مشكلة في ملف الترخيص، فستتلقى استثناءً. يمكنك تخصيص معالجة الأخطاء وفقًا لاحتياجات التطبيق الخاص بك.

6. اختبار تطبيق Aspose.Words المرخص لديك

بعد تطبيق الترخيص، اختبر تطبيق Aspose.Words الخاص بك جيدًا للتأكد من أن جميع الميزات تعمل كما هو متوقع. تعتبر هذه الخطوة ضرورية لضمان إنشاء مستنداتك دون أي قيود تجريبية.

كود المصدر الكامل

        License license = new License();
        //يحاول هذا السطر تعيين ترخيص من عدة مواقع بالنسبة إلى الملف القابل للتنفيذ وAspose.Words.dll.
        // يمكنك أيضًا استخدام التحميل الزائد الإضافي لتحميل ترخيص من الدفق، وهذا مفيد،
        // على سبيل المثال، عندما يتم تخزين الترخيص كمورد مضمن.
        try
        {
            license.setLicense("Aspose.Words.lic");
            System.out.println("License set successfully.");
        }
        catch (Exception e)
        {
            // نحن لا نشحن أي ترخيص بهذا المثال،
            // قم بزيارة موقع Aspose للحصول على ترخيص مؤقت أو دائم.
            System.out.println("\nThere was an error setting the license: " + e.getMessage());
        }

تطبيق الترخيص من الدفق

    public void applyLicenseFromStream() throws Exception
    {
        License license = new License();
        try
        {
            license.setLicense(new FileInputStream(new File("Aspose.Words.lic")));
            System.out.println("License set successfully.");
        }
        catch (Exception e)
        {
            // نحن لا نشحن أي ترخيص بهذا المثال،
            // قم بزيارة موقع Aspose للحصول على ترخيص مؤقت أو دائم.
            System.out.println("\nThere was an error setting the license: " + e.getMessage());
        }
    }

تطبيق الترخيص المقنن

    public void applyMeteredLicense() {
        try
        {
            Metered metered = new Metered();
            metered.setMeteredKey("### ***", "***");
            Document doc = new Document("Your Directory Path" + "Document.docx");
            System.out.println(doc.getPageCount());
        }
        catch (Exception e)
        {
            System.out.println("\nThere was an error setting the license: " + e.getMessage());
        }

7. الخاتمة

في هذا البرنامج التعليمي، قمنا بتغطية الخطوات الأساسية لتطبيق الترخيص على Aspose.Words for Java. يعد الترخيص أمرًا حيويًا لإطلاق الإمكانات الكاملة لهذه المكتبة القوية. يمكنك الآن إنشاء مستندات Word وتحريرها ومعالجتها في تطبيقات Java الخاصة بك بسلاسة.

الأسئلة الشائعة

كيف يمكنني الحصول على ترخيص مؤقت لـ Aspose.Words لـ Java؟

قم بزيارةAspose صفحة الترخيص المؤقتة لطلب ترخيص مؤقت.

هل يمكنني استخدام Aspose.Words لـ Java بدون ترخيص؟

نعم، ولكنه سيعمل في الوضع التجريبي مع وجود قيود. من المستحسن الحصول على ترخيص صالح للوظائف الكاملة.

أين يمكنني العثور على دعم إضافي لـ Aspose.Words لـ Java؟

يمكنك زيارةAspose.Words لمنتدى دعم جافا للمساعدة والمناقشات.

هل Aspose.Words for Java متوافق مع أحدث إصدارات Java؟

يتم تحديث Aspose.Words for Java بانتظام لضمان التوافق مع أحدث إصدارات Java.

هل هناك أي نماذج مشاريع متاحة لـ Aspose.Words لـ Java؟

نعم، يمكنك العثور على نماذج المشاريع وأمثلة التعليمات البرمجية في وثائق Aspose.Words for Java.

الآن بعد أن أصبح لديك فهم شامل لتطبيق الترخيص على Aspose.Words for Java، يمكنك البدء في الاستفادة من ميزاته القوية لمعالجة المستندات في تطبيقات Java الخاصة بك.